Supervisory Program Analyst (Data Confidentiality Officer)

Discussion

The Bureau of Labor Statistics measures labor market activity, working conditions, price changes, and productivity in the U.S. economy to support public and private decision making. The position is located in the Bureau of Labor Statistics, Office of Administration.

Duties include, but are not limited to, the following: Develops, directs, and implements a program to establish and maintain the confidentiality of BLS respondent-identifiable statistical data Directs BLS activities nation-wide related to policy and legal matters and provides assistance and advice to BLS managers and staff Coordinates all BLS Freedom of Information Act (FOIA) requests and directs BLS activities related to FOIA Manages the development and implementation of BLS management policies and programs with a nationwide scope Develops and carries out ad hoc management studies as well as continuously scheduled program reviews to evaluate, advise on, and improve the effectiveness of work methods and procedures
